The previous MoTeC unit sold for $2900. The PLM sells for $1300, samples four times faster, is more accurate and costs less to run as replacement oxygen sensors are cheaper than the previous model.

The unit is a Techedge OZ DIY Kit with a NTK UEGO sensor. I think you can get the whole sheband (minus the considerable cost of an expert like nolimit's labor) for ~$500-600 shipped!
